How We Work
1
Emergency Contact
Your urgent call initiates our rapid response. We gather critical information, assess the water damage over the phone, and dispatch a certified team to your Sugar Land location immediately to prevent further damage.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ately map the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our comprehensive drying plan and prepares for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ade extractors remove standing water. We then strategically place d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ry affected areas, preventing mold growth and preparing for restoration.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ated materials are safely removed. We apply antimicrobial treatments to sanitize all surfaces, ensuring a clean and healthy environment. This step ensures readiness for structural repairs and reconstruction.
5
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ged building materials, rest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. A final walkthrough ensures your complete satisfaction with our work and the restored space.

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Removal

What causes water damage in crawl spaces?

Water damage in crawl spaces can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, plumbing leaks, and poor ventilation.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em.

How long does it take to remove water from a crawl space?

The time it takes to remove water from a crawl space can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the amount of water present. Our team works quickly to get the job done.
